The page scanner is awful. You will hold it so only a the page you want can be seen and then it somehow grabs 1/3 of the other page and distorts it making it unusable. Then once to finally scan the pages you want it to read, Read4Me randomly closes out on you every few minutes and you have to try to find where you were again. I have another app that scans pages and turns it into perfectly good PDFs that no other app has an issue with, but when I try to import those into Read4Me, it thinks it’s not a PDF.
So in summary, for $50 a month you get an app that can’t scan pages without major issues, won’t import PDFs as it says it does, and crashes every few minutes.

Decided to try out Read4Me and absolutely loved it at first. I travel a lot and like to listen to articles, books, etc while I’m flying. But if there isn’t a constant internet connection, Read4Me doesn’t work and keeps asking to check the connection. I’m not sure why that’s necessary. Especially for pdf files or ebooks downloaded to my phone. The voices are very nice and the sentences are read w/ fluidity as opposed to sounding robotic like most apps. I may have considered paying the requested amount had I been able to use Read4Me offline.
